5 Section 19. Section 828.261, Florida Statutes, is created
6 to read:
7 828.261 Ongoing horse care covenants.—
8 (1) Notwithstanding any other provision of law, a contract
9 for the sale of a horse may include a covenant for the
10 continuing care of the horse, subject to the following
11 provisions:
12 (a) The obligations under the covenant may be satisfied by
13 a third-party provider who is contractually obligated to provide
14 continuing care for the horse upon its retirement, for an
15 actuarially appropriate charge, which is not subject to chapter
16 624.
17 (b) The covenant is valid and annexed to the horse, runs
18 with the horse, and is binding and enforceable upon all future
19 purchasers, if notice is provided pursuant to paragraph (c).
20 (c) Written notice of the covenant must be provided to all
21 purchasers before a sale and must be acknowledged in writing by
22 all such purchasers before consummation of the sale of a covered
23 horse.
24 (d) The covenant must include liability for liquidated
25 damages for a purchaser’s failure to comply with the covenant.
26 (e) The covenant must include the ability of an owner to
27 retire the horse into the care of the third-party provider under
28 the covenant.
29 (f) A third-party provider who is contracted to provide the
30 continuing care of a horse under the covenant shall, at a
31 minimum, comply with the American Association of Equine
32 Practitioners care guidelines for equine rescue and retirement
33 facilities.
34 (2) An owner is not required to put in place a covenant for
35 the continuing care of a horse and a purchaser is not required
36 to purchase a horse that is subject to such a covenant.
37 (3) This section does not create any covenants that annex
38 to or travel with any other chattel.
